Masking of Federal Law Enforcement

  • 📌 DC Mayor Muriel Bowser stated she asked Chief Smith to address the administration regarding federal officers masking their faces.
  • 💡 Bowser believes there is no need for law enforcement officers to cover their faces while performing their duties.
  • ✅ She highlighted that MPD officers are identified by badges, wear body cameras, and are clearly identifiable to the public.
  • 🔍 The Mayor noted that federal officials are wearing identifiable uniforms or vests, appearing to be from DHS agencies rather than DOJ agencies.

Rationale Against Masking

  • ❓ Bowser questioned why federal officials, paid by taxpayers, would need to wear masks while performing their jobs.
  • ⚖️ She emphasized that law enforcement should conduct their work in a lawful and constitutional manner.
  • ⚠️ While acknowledging masks can be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) in certain situations like drug enforcement, she stated this is not the case for the current operations.
  • 🗣️ The Mayor reiterated her stance: "I don't know why anybody needs to wear a mask."
